高虹镇稻米中重金属污染状况及健康风险评价  被引量:3

Heavy metal pollution in rice of Gaohong Town with a health risk assessment

摘  要:为调查浙江省高虹镇稻米重金属污染状况及其对人体健康的影响,从高虹镇采集了51个本地稻米样品和37个市售外地稻米样品进行分析。采用污染指数法、相关性分析及聚类分析法评价了高虹镇本地和市售稻米中的重金属污染状况和分布特征。依据对当地居民进行的问卷调查结果,采用危险商法和高危指数法评价了稻米中的重金属对当地居民可能造成的风险。结果表明:高虹镇稻米铬、砷和铅的污染比较严重,分别为0.03~13.45mg·kg-1,0.01~1.64 mg·kg-1和0.04~7.84 mg·kg-1,超标比率分别为70.59%,31.37%和27.45%。本地稻米和市售稻米的综合污染指数分别为3.01和1.95,整体上分别处于重度污染和轻度污染的水平。本地稻米和市售稻米的高危指数值分别为3.50和2.18,食用高虹镇本地产稻米对人体潜在的健康风险更大。To assess the heavy metal contamination in rice and human health risks induced by rice consumption in Gaohong Town, Zhejiang Province, 51 local and 37 commercial rice samples were collected and analyzed for heavy metal concentrations. This was followed by a pollution index calculation, correlation analysis, and cluster analysis. In addition, potential health risk through rice consumption was evaluated using a hazard index(IHI)based on the data and questionnaire surveys. Results showed that rice samples were contaminated by Cr, As,and Pb in Gaohong Town with concentration ranges of 0.03-13.45 mg·kg-1 for Cr, 0.01-1.64 mg·kg-1 for As,and 0.04-7.84 mg·kg-1 for Pb. Of the rice samples that exceeded the National Food Safety Standard, 70.59%were Cr, 31.37% were As, and 27.45% were Pb. The comprehensive pollution index of local rice reached 3.01,which implied a moderate pollution level. By comparison, the pollution index of commercial rice from external sources was 1.95, meaning a mild pollution level. The IHIvalue of local rice samples was 3.50, and for market rice samples it was 2.18. Thus, the overall health risk from heavy metals induced through local rice consumption was higher than commercial rice.
